题目描述
输入n个整数,输出出现次数大于等于数组长度一半的数。
输入描述:
每个测试输入包含 n个空格分割的n个整数,n不超过100,其中有一个整数出现次数大于等于n/2。
输出描述:
输出出现次数大于等于n/2的数。
示例1
输入
复制
3 9 3 2 5 6 7 3 2 3 3 3
输出
复制
3
def count_1(list1):
count1=[0,0,0,0,0,0,0,0,0,0]
for i in range(len(list1)):
for j in range(10):
if list1[i]==j:
count1[j]=count1[j]+1
a=count1.index(max(count1))
return(int(a))
m=input()
nums = [int(t) for t in m.strip().split()]
out=count_1(nums)
print(out)